You can use the Google Drive app to get notifications in Google Chat about activity in Drive.
Learn about Google Drive notifications in Chat
If you turn on notifications, you get direct messages about Google Drive events, such as:
- A new file or folder that's shared with you.
- A new comment or action item that mentions you or is assigned to you.
- You can reply to comments directly from the Google Drive app for Chat. For example, to mention a colleague, type '@' followed by their name or email address.
- An access request to a file that you own.
Before you begin
- You need permission from your Google Workspace administrator to install apps.
- You need to add the app to Chat. Learn how to find apps and add them to Chat.
Turn on Google Drive notifications in Chat or Gmail
- Open the Chat app or Gmail app .
- Send any direct message (such as 'hello') to the Google Drive app.
- In the response, tap Turn on notifications.
Turn off Google Drive notifications in Chat or Gmail
- Open the Chat app or Gmail app .
- Send any direct message (such as 'hello') to the Google Drive app.
- In the response, tap Turn off notifications.
To turn notifications back on, send another direct message to the Google Drive app.
